The Rolex GMT-Master is one of the most recognisable watches in the world, and with good reason. Over its many years in production since 1954, it has been a prime example of Rolex’s development process - that is, staying much the same in 2023 as it was over half a century prior, but with incremental changes and advancements that keep it contemporary with each new reference.

Initially designed for Pan Am Airways as a pilot’s watch, the purpose was to allow tracking of both the local time and UTC (GMT), the time zone designated for all flight planning and scheduling. Over the years it has seen a multitude of visual and mechanical changes but largely serves the same purpose as it did in ‘54.

Today, it is a symbol of luxury as one of the most flexible watches in Rolex’s lineup whether that be travelling, the office, playing golf, or just those special moments between yourself and your favourite timepiece in the bath…

This reference, the 116710BLRN, was introduced a little over ten years ago and saw the first use of the blue and black bezel combination (hence BLNR - Bleu/Noir) which has earned it the “Batman” moniker after the caped crusader’s occasional blue & black getup. Featuring a quick-set hour hand, patented Cerachrom bezel, and a clean black maxi-dial, this is one of the most modern, functional and, let’s be honest, coolest Rolex models out there.
